Understanding Big Data Analytics Techniques
Big data analytics techniques involve a variety of methodologies that organizations implement to analyze and interpret large and complex datasets. These techniques typically encompass several critical processes, including data mining, machine learning, statistical analysis, and predictive analytics. Each method offers unique advantages and plays a significant role in delivering actionable insights.
– Data Mining: This technique focuses on discovering patterns and relationships in large datasets. It involves the use of algorithms to analyze data and extract information that can inform decision-making processes.
– Machine Learning: By leveraging algorithms that allow computers to learn from and make predictions based on data, organizations can enhance their predictive capabilities significantly.
– Statistical Analysis: This essential technique employs statistical tests to evaluate and interpret data. It aids in hypothesis testing and data interpretation, enabling businesses to make informed decisions based on empirical evidence.
– Predictive Analytics: Utilizing data, AI, and machine learning, this method allows businesses to forecast future outcomes based on historical data patterns. Predictive analytics is fundamental for risk management, customer segmentation, and profit maximization strategies.

Key Concepts You Should Know
To fully grasp the significance of big data analytics methods, it is essential to understand several key concepts. These concepts form the foundational knowledge necessary for effectively applying analytics techniques in real-world scenarios.
1. Data Sources
Understanding the various sources of data is crucial. Data can originate from structured databases, unstructured text, social media interactions, and streaming data from IoT devices. An organization’s ability to integrate these diverse data sources effectively is fundamental to capturing comprehensive insights.
2. Real-Time Analytics
Real-time analytics refers to the capacity to analyze data as it is generated. This capability is invaluable for businesses that require immediate insights for operations such as fraud detection, customer service, and real-time marketing adjustments. 3. Data Visualization
The ability to present data in a visually appealing and easily interpretable manner is critical for effective communication. Data visualization techniques, including dashboards and infographics, facilitate better understanding among stakeholders, enabling quicker decision-making.
4. Cloud Computing
Cloud computing enhances data storage and scalability for big data solutions. Organizations can utilize cloud platforms for their analytical needs, which helps in reducing infrastructure costs while providing flexibility in data management.

What are the key challenges in big data analytics?
Engaging with big data analytics presents several challenges for organizations. Some of the primary obstacles include data privacy and security concerns, integration of disparate data sources, and the need for skilled talent to interpret complex datasets.
For many businesses, one of the pressing issues is ensuring compliance with data protection regulations while leveraging big data analytics. As data privacy laws continue to evolve, organizations must stay vigilant to avoid legal pitfalls. Furthermore, integrating data from multiple sources—such as IoT devices, social media, and traditional databases—requires advanced technical solutions. Moreover, the demand for skilled data scientists and analysts is ever-growing. Organizations struggle to find personnel who possess not only the technical skills necessary for analyzing big data but also the contextual knowledge of the industry. Training existing employees or leveraging consulting services can be effective strategies for addressing this skills gap.
How can organizations adopt big data analytics effectively?
Adopting big data analytics is a multifaceted process that requires thoughtful planning and execution. To begin with, organizations should evaluate their data infrastructure to ensure they have the necessary systems in place. This includes assessing data storage solutions, processing capabilities, and analytical tools.
Next, identifying specific business objectives is paramount. Organizations need to clarify how they intend to use big data analytics—whether it be to drive sales growth, enhance customer experience, or streamline operations. This focus will guide the selection of analytical methods and technologies.
Implementing a phased approach is another effective strategy. Organizations can start with small pilot projects to test the waters before further investments. Such projects can provide valuable insights into what tools and processes work best for their specific context. What role does data governance play in big data analytics?
Data governance refers to the policies and procedures that ensure proper data management and usage within an organization. When it comes to big data analytics, effective data governance is essential for a variety of reasons.
Firstly, solid data governance frameworks promote data accuracy, consistency, and security—critical elements for reliable analytics. Without proper oversight, organizations risk basing their decisions on flawed data, which can lead to detrimental outcomes.
Secondly, having clear data governance policies facilitates compliance with legal and regulatory requirements, particularly those relating to data privacy and protection. By establishing protocols for data access and usage, organizations can safeguard sensitive information and avoid potential legal repercussions.
Finally, robust data governance enhances collaboration across departments. When everyone adheres to the same data policies and practices, it fosters a unified approach to data analysis, leading to more coherent and actionable insights.
